Why These Are the Top Roofing Contractors in Riverton

Riverton's roofing market is characterized by a high demand for storm resilience and historic home expertise. Located in Burlington County near the Delaware River, the area experiences nor'easters, heavy rainfall, and high winds, making wind-rated shingles, proper flashing, and waterproofing critical. Many homes are historic, requiring contractors skilled in traditional materials like slate and tile, as well as adherence to specific preservation codes. The top contractors are well-versed in working with insurance companies for storm-related claims.

1What is the typical cost range for a full roof replacement on a Riverton home?

For a typical Riverton single-family home (1,500-2,500 sq. ft.), a full asphalt shingle roof replacement generally ranges from $8,500 to $15,000. Final costs depend on roof complexity, material choice (e.g., architectural shingles cost more), and the extent of underlying decking repair needed. New Jersey's higher labor and material costs compared to national averages, along with local disposal fees, are key factors in this pricing.

2When is the best time of year to schedule roofing work in Riverton, NJ?

The ideal windows are late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October). These periods typically offer mild, dry weather which is optimal for installation and material adhesion. It's wise to schedule well in advance, as reputable contractors book quickly after summer storms and before winter. Avoid deep winter due to ice and snow hazards and high summer due to potential for sudden thunderstorms.

3Are there specific local permits or regulations I need to be aware of for a roofing project in Riverton?

Yes, Riverton requires a building permit for a full roof replacement, which your contractor should typically obtain. The Borough of Riverton follows the New Jersey Uniform Construction Code (NJUCC), which includes specific requirements for wind uplift resistance. Given our proximity to the Delaware River and occasional coastal storm remnants, ensuring your new roof meets or exceeds NJ's high-wind zone requirements (often 110+ mph) is crucial for longevity and insurance.

4How do I choose a reliable roofing contractor in the Riverton/Burlington County area?

Prioritize contractors who are licensed, insured, and have a strong local reputation with physical addresses. Always verify their New Jersey Home Improvement Contractor (HIC) registration number. Ask for references from recent projects in Riverton or neighboring towns like Palmyra or Cinnaminson, and check for manufacturer certifications (like GAF or CertainTeed) which indicate training on proper installation techniques for our climate.

5What are the most common roof problems you see on older homes in Riverton?

We frequently see issues related to our humid, variable climate: moss/algae growth on north-facing slopes, damaged or missing shingles from nor'easter wind gusts, and leaks around aging chimney flashings. Many historic Riverton homes also have original slate or wood roofs that require specialized repair. Proactive inspection for these issues after major seasonal storms is highly recommended to prevent interior water damage.
